2kcal Tube Feed Study

Evaluation of a Nutritionally Complete, Plant-based, High Energy, High Protein, Enteral Tube Feed in Adults

Conditions

Cancer, Enteral Nutrition

Brief summary

The primary aim of this study is to investigate the effects of a plant-based, high energy, high protein tube feed with and without inclusion of fibre on gastrointestinal tolerance in adult patients who require nutritional support via enteral tube feeding over a 28-day period, followed by a 12-month follow-up. Secondary aims are to determine the effects on compliance, acceptability, anthropometry, nutrient intake, and physical function. This is a prospective, longitudinal, 28-day intervention study with a 1-day baseline period and a 1-year follow-up.

Interventions

DIETARY_SUPPLEMENT2kcal HP PlantBased

Patients will receive a minimum of 1 bottle per day of either (or both of) 2kcal HP PlantBased and/or 2kcal HP PlantBased MultiFibre Tube Feeds for a minimum of 7 days and a maximum of 28 days. During the 12-month follow-up, patients will have access to the same trial prescription as per the 28-day intervention period.

Inclusion criteria

* Male or female * ≥16 years of age * Using or requiring an enteral tube feed in the community as part of nutritional management plan * Expected to receive at least 1000kcal/day (one bottle) from one of the study products

Exclusion criteria

* Receiving parenteral nutrition * Patients with major hepatic dysfunction (i.e., decompensated liver disease) * Patients with major renal dysfunction (i.e., requiring filtration or stage 4/5 chronic kidney disease (CKD)) * Patients receiving inpatient care * Known pregnancy or lactation * Participation in other clinical intervention studies within 1 month of this study * Allergy to any study product ingredients * Investigator concern regarding ability or willingness of patient to comply with the study requirements.

Design outcomes

Primary

MeasureTime frameDescription
Change in gastrointestinal toleranceChange from baseline (Day 1) to end of intervention (7-28 days)A standardised gastrointestinal (GI) tolerance questionnaire to capture perceived severity (none, mild, moderate or severe) of common gastrointestinal symptoms (diarrhoea, constipation, bloating, abdominal discomfort, vomiting and nausea).

Secondary

MeasureTime frameDescription
AcceptabilityBaseline to end of intervention (7-28 days) and end of follow-up (12 months)Acceptability (e.g., liking, ease of use, preference) will be assessed by a questionnaire. Questions will be rated on a 7-point Likert scale.
ComplianceBaseline to end of intervention (7-28 days) and end of follow-up (12 months)Compliance with the study product prescription (%) will be assessed daily by recording how much of the study product was prescribed compared to the amount administered.
Dietary intakeBaseline to end of intervention (7-28 days) and end of follow-up (12 months)A 24-h dietary recall will be conducted to record all food, drink and nutritional feeds taken in the 24 hours prior for analysis of of nutritional intake (i.e., total energy and macro- and micronutrients).
AnthropometryBaseline to end of intervention (7-28 days) and end of follow-up (12 months)Body weight (kg) will be measured using standard methods to the nearest 0.1kg using a weighing scale without heavy clothing. Height will be measured at baseline only using standard measures to the nearest 0.1cm, without shoes or socks. . Height and weight measures will be used to calculate body mass index (BMI).
Handgrip strength6-months to 12-months follow-upDominant handgrip strength (kg) will be assessed using a handgrip dynamometer
Safety (Adverse events)Baseline to end of intervention (7-28 days) and end of follow-up (12 months)Adverse events will be recorded throughout the study
Calf circumference6-months to 12-months follow-upCalf circumference (of the dominant leg) will be measured using standard measures to the nearest 0.1cm using a measuring tape
30-s Chair Stand Test6-months to 12-months follow-upNumber of times patients can stand up and sit down from a chair as many times as possible within 30 seconds.
Dietetic goalBaseline to end of intervention (7-28 days) and end of follow-up (12 months)A dietetic goal (e.g., weight increase/maintenance, improved/maintained GI tolerance, improved/maintained compliance) will be set by the investigating dietitian at baseline (Day 1) for each patient. At the end of the intervention period, the investigating dietitian will assess and note if the dietetic goal was met.
